Transaction 80e5337f63ea5b4307a1e9786623f7aa7134fc5361097311d546edb72db386fa
1 Input
2 Outputs
- 80e5337f63ea5b4307a1e9786623f7aa7134fc5361097311d546edb72db386fa:0
- 80e5337f63ea5b4307a1e9786623f7aa7134fc5361097311d546edb72db386fa:1
value 976542539
address n4fMFnyg95TMn1XfqMfEzvEcYnSJowUmLX
value 976542539
address n4fLTpGc2v2ktS9LgboDncAw8TQ9GLV7P3